my friend recently installed a 5900xt (replacing a ti4400) and whenever he scrolls through menus (like while scrolling up or down in a webbrowser), he gets a buzzing sound in his speakers. any suggestions as to what is causing this, or how to fix it?

I also have this issue with my PNY FX5900U. Lots of scrolling does it. Selecting "auto-overclock" in coolbits makes it beep rapidly. Very strange. Also, testing manual overclocks I think does it. Furthermore, when it makes noise, my monitor dims a very slight bit.

...A little weird. Solutions, anyone?

When i first installed my 5900, it made some type of chirping/buzzing noise every time i would scroll up or down a webpage. Awhile ago i was told that it was normal and it was from the capacitors discharging energy to my video card.

Perhaps theres a grounding issue that causes the speakers to pick it up? But anyway, the noise is caused by the capacitors.

But my monitor gets darker when it happens. That worries me. Also, it has to be coming from the system speaker or motherboard beeper thing, if not directly from the card itself. I unplugged my speakers, soundcard, and system speaker. It still happened.

i have a 5900 ultra, and it also makes a "chirping noise" everytime i scroll up or down on a webpage. the noise comes directly from the card itself on my system. i also read somewhere that it comes from the capacitators. what i find strange is that it affects your monitor, it might be a grounding issue.
